For me, 2020 seems to be the year of the granny stitch blanket. So far I’ve finished a long standing WIP from 2019, and started and finished a granny star and granny c2c. My latest completed project is a granny ripple blanket that I began in February.
I’m by no means a fast crocheter and I find that I get frustrated pretty quickly when it comes to complicated projects. So, granny stitch projects are my favourite and an easy mindfulness project for these strange times. This latest blanket is a mix of four Stylecraft DK colours, Cream, Parma Violet, Duck Egg and Clematis. Apparently the majority of my projects always involve some shade of purple and/or pink!

I found a great written pattern with photographs on Pinterest by Just be Crafty. I finished with a border of one row of half treble stitches followed by a row of treble crochets.


As with many of my projects, I just kept going until it was the size I wanted, usually doing three or four rows an evening. The finished piece is 150cm long and 66cm wide. A perfect size to cosy up with on the sofa!
